在Qt中,命名约定可以提高代码的可读性和可维护性。以下是一些建议的命名约定:
- 类名:使用大驼峰命名法,即每个单词的首字母大写,例如:MyCustomWidget。
- 变量名和函数名:使用小驼峰命名法,即第一个单词首字母小写,后面每个单词首字母大写,例如:myCustomVariable。
- 常量名:使用全大写字母,单词之间用下划线分隔,例如:MY_CONSTANT。
- 私有成员变量:在变量名前加上下划线,例如:_myPrivateVariable。
- 受保护的成员变量:在变量名前加上双下划线,例如:__myProtectedVariable。
- 槽函数名:使用小写字母,单词之间用下划线分隔,例如:my_custom_slot。
- 信号名:使用小写字母,单词之间用下划线分隔,例如:my_custom_signal。
这些命名约定可以帮助开发者更容易地理解和维护代码。同时,遵循这些约定可以确保代码的一致性和可读性。